Title: New feature: Stickied posts within threads
Post by: Prime32 on June 30, 2017, 03:46:50 PM
Within a thread you've started, post a reply and put (Continued) at the start of the Subject field - it will be stickied underneath the OP. This works everywhere on the boards, but you can't sticky a post in someone else's thread. Should be useful for Handbooks and similar threads.

This feature was available on the temporary boards, but it might not have got a lot of attention.
